How to measure management effectiveness in health institutions?

ABSTRACT

The effectiveness in the management of organizations is understood as the degree to which the objectives are met, and it has a great relationship with the quality perceived by the users. That is why its correct identification and measurement should be a concern for all companies and organizations, especially in social sectors such as health, where the satisfaction of the needs of patients, family members and other interested parties is the maximum expression of success. The research aims to analyze what is known about the measurement of effectiveness in health organizations. In order to comply with the proposed objective, a literature search was carried out on the most recent studies conducted in Ibero-America regarding the measurement of efficacy in the health sector. In general, the complexity and integrality of the process of measuring health efficacy was recognized. The measurement of effectiveness should focus on indicators related to physical, mental and social well-being; what must be guaranteed by the planning systems of health organizations.
